AT 201 - Art Drawing II


Credit Hours: 3

This course is a continuation of AT 200 involving the study of pictoral structure and expanded interpretation that may include the drawing of objects, nature, and/or the figure.

Course Outcomes
Upon completion of this course, the student will be able to:

  1. demonstrate a willingness to experiment in various drawing media;
  2. experiment and develop independent drawing and design solutions; and
  3. critique drawings and art through acceptable vocabulary and research library paper.


Prerequisites: AT 200 or permission of the instructor.
